我试图让一个红宝石应用程序在FreeBSD 12上运行,但我似乎失败得很惨烈。
我通过pkg install v8安装了v8,并尝试通过以下命令安装libv8 gem:
gem install libv8 -v '7.3.492.27.1' -- --with-system-v8这似乎工作得很好,直到它调用拒绝在FreeBSD上运行的gclient
KeyError: 'freebsd12'我找了很多,但找不到解决这个问题的办法。有没有办法让libv8在FreeBSD上工作?
发布于 2019-06-26 22:23:24
根据libv8 repo中this issue中的注释,在6.0版之后的FreeBSD中没有二进制gem。
您可以尝试从源代码构建或使用降级版本
https://stackoverflow.com/questions/56774403
复制相似问题